import { toDate } from "./toDate.js";
/**
* @name isFuture
* @category Common Helpers
* @summary Is the given date in the future?
* @pure false
*
* @description
* Is the given date in the future?
*
* @param date - The date to check
*
* @returns The date is in the future
*
* @example
* // If today is 6 October 2014, is 31 December 2014 in the future?
* const result = isFuture(new Date(2014, 11, 31))
* //=> true
*/
export function isFuture(date) {
return +toDate(date) > Date.now();
}
// Fallback for modularized imports:
export default isFuture;
